Rebecca “Becky” Maxine (Porter) Powell was born August 31, 1947, the daughter of Max and Clare (Harris) Porter in Massena, Iowa. She entered into rest, after a long battle with cancer, on February 4, 2018 at the Taylor Hospice House in Des Moines, Iowa.

Becky grew up in rural Massena. She started country school at the age of 4 and graduated from Massena High School in 1965. In June 1965 she was united in marriage to Donald Powell. To this union came three girls: Carrie LaVonne, Tammie Jo, and Misty Dawn. For many years she worked as a bookkeeper for her father’s construction company. She was a member of the Massena Volunteer Fire Department for over 20 years and she took much pride in serving the community that she lived in.

In 1998, Becky moved from Massena. She met her significant other, John Deaton in July of 2007. Following her retirement from Mediacom in March of 2011, she and John enjoyed spending their days together. They shared a love of music, old TV shows, scary movies and taking short trips together.

Becky loved her daughters and was proud of each of their accomplishments. Her grandchildren were the light of her life and she enjoyed spoiling them with goodies, attending their events when she was able and babysitting.

She was preceded in death by her parents; sister, Carol and her husband James Hodge; sister, Betty Jane and her husband Richard Stice; brother, William “Bill” Porter and nephews, Danny Hodge, Reggie Hodge and Matt Schrier.

Surviving her are her significant other John Deaton of Des Moines; daughters, Carrie Ross-Stanley (David) of Des Moines, Tammie Marshall (David) of Johnston, and Misty Sachs (Greg) of Ames; John’s children; John Deaton Jr. (Tahairah) of Des Moines, Joe Deaton (Ashley) of Des Moines. Grandchildren: Candice Ross, Jacob (Rachel) Ross, Emily Marshall, Nathan Marshall, Owen Sachs, Donovan Sachs, Lincoln Sachs, Zach Deaton, and Ben Deaton. Great Grandchildren: Lilly Richter, Lexi Richter, Bristol Richter, Gage Richter, Savannah Ross and Brayton Ross. Nieces, nephews, relatives and friends.
